Intercity Regional Trail - Drainage and Storm Sewer Design

TKDA helped improve pedestrian traffic with new urban trail

Three Rivers Park District wanted to improve pedestrian traffic with a new multi-use off-road trail from Minneapolis to Bloomington along the Cedar Avenue corridor. TKDA provided drainage, storm sewer design, hydraulic modeling and permitting for the 3.6-mile urban trail connection.

In addition to a new pedestrian bridge over I-494, the project included 75 catch basins and 1,500 feet of storm sewer and culverts, one infiltration basin and a floodplain assessment. TKDA also assisted with obtaining the MPCA NPDES Construction Storm Water Permit and the Minnehaha Creek Watershed District Permit.
